Dr. Sam Koo graduated from Mercer University School of Medicine in 2005.
Dr. Koo has five offices in Ohio, Kentucky and Indiana where he specializes in Hand Surgery and Orthopedic Surgery.
Dr. Koo works with nineteen doctors including Dr. Justin Kruer and Dr. Angel Velazquez-santiago.
A hand surgeon in Indiana, Dr. Koo cares for injuries and complications of the hand, fingers, wrist, forearm, elbow and shoulder. Dr. Koo is specifically trained to diagnose each patient and determine whether or not surgical intervention is medically necessary, as surgery is usually seen as a last resort when other treatment methods have been exhausted. As a result, treatment can be surgical or non-surgical in nature.
As an orthopedic surgeon in Indiana, Dr. Koo is trained to detect and treat all forms of damage to the musculoskeletal system, including the tendons, ligaments, joints, bones, and muscles. Once a diagnosis has been achieved, Dr. Koo will typically resort to surgery when other treatment plans have been exhausted or eliminated. Patients may require the attention of an orthopedic surgeon for sports injuries, sprains, torn ligaments, fractures, and more.
